Construct a named scheduler with event capacity, default dispatcher, and given clock.

Synopsis

Declared in <bdlmt_timereventscheduler.h>

TimerEventScheduler(
    int numEvents,
    int numClocks,
    bsls::SystemClockType::Enum clockType,
    std::string_view const& eventSchedulerName,
    bdlm::MetricsRegistry* metricsRegistry,
    bslma::Allocator* basicAllocator = 0);

Description

Construct a timer event scheduler using the default dispatcher functor (see the "The dispatcher thread and the dispatcher functor" section in component level doc) that has the capability to concurrently schedule at least the specified numEvents and numClocks, use the specified clockType to indicate the epoch used for all time intervals (see []Clock‐Types) in the component documentation), the specified eventSchedulerName to be used to identify this event scheduler, and the specified metricsRegistry to be used for reporting metrics. If metricsRegistry is 0, bdlm::MetricsRegistry::singleton() is used. Optionally specify a basicAllocator used to supply memory. If basicAllocator is 0, the currently installed default allocator is used. The behavior is undefined unless 0 <= numEvents < 2**24 and 0 <= numClocks < 2**24.

Parameters

Name

Description

numEvents

minimum concurrent one‐shot events supported

numClocks

minimum concurrent clocks supported

clockType

clock used for time intervals

eventSchedulerName

name identifying this scheduler

metricsRegistry

metrics registry, or singleton if 0

basicAllocator

memory allocator; null uses the default
